DEFAULT POWER-UP BUTTONS
An output mode, output sync format or a factory reset may be selected without the use of the
IN1408 menu. This is particularly useful if the monitor does not display an image or if the image
is scrambled. Simply hold down the front panel button while turning on the IN1408. The front
panel buttons perform the following functions:
INPUT 1:
Factory Reset
INPUT 2:
Set Output Format to RGBHV--
INPUT 3:
Set Output Format to RGBHV++
INPUT 4:
Set Output Format to RGBS
BLANK:
Set Output Format to RGsB
FREEZE:
Enable Front Panel
MENU:
640 x 480 @ 60 Hz
LEFT:
800 x 600 @ 60 Hz
UP:
1024 x 768 @ 60 Hz
DOWN:
1152 x 864 @ 60 Hz
RIGHT:
1280 x 1024 @ 60 Hz
ENTER:
Factory Reset
OUTPUT POSITIONING
The output position may be adjusted without entering the main menu sequence. Pressing the
arrow keys selects the output position controls if the menu is not on. Afterwards, press enter to
save the output position, or press menu to exit without saving the setting.
The output position simply moves the image on the monitor. It does not add blank borders or
crop any part of the image. However, the apparent effect of blank borders and a cropped image
may be due to the image being incorrectly positioned on the monitor. The blue screen is available
to adjust the output image on the monitor. It as available at any time, even when the input
settings are incorrectly adjusted or the input signal is missing entirely. Use the blue screen to
adjust the output settings (resolution, refresh rate, size, position and sync format) and to verify the
image on the monitor. The video and input settings have no effect on the blue screen. Once the
output settings have been properly adjusted and verified on the monitor, the blue screen can be
turned off, and the video and input settings may then be adjusted.
